SSO单点登录流程:
1.当用户第一次登陆时,先通过SSO单点登录系统进行登录操作.
2.根据用户信息查询用户数据验证登录是否有效
3.如果用户名和密码都正确,则生成ticket.并将User对象转化为JSON数据
4.将ticket和UserJSON数据写入redis缓存中
5.当用户登陆成功后,在cookie保存ticket信息.
6.当用户再次访问前台系统时,首先根据ticket信息,查询redis缓存服务器.获取用户数据.
7.当用户访问购物车时,首先前台会校验,根据ticket查询用户信息,如果用户没有登陆则转向单点登录系统.
8.当用户访问订单系统时,首先前台会校验,根据ticket查询用户信息,如果没有该用户信息,则转向单点登录系统.
SSO单点登录完美解决session共享问题